How Many Peloton Subscribers?

Let’s delve into the thrilling world of Peloton, where fitness and technology fuse seamlessly to create an unparalleled workout experience. With approximately 6 million global subscribers, Peloton has firmly established itself as a frontrunner in the home fitness industry. These numbers reflect the widespread appeal and effectiveness of Peloton’s innovative approach to exercise.

What sets Peloton apart is not only the sheer number of subscribers but also the impressive retention rate. A remarkable 90% of members choose to stick with their Peloton membership for over a year, highlighting the company’s ability to foster long-term commitment and loyalty among its users.

Since September 2019, Peloton has experienced a rapid surge in new memberships, with an average growth rate exceeding 500,000. This exponential rise demonstrates the growing popularity and widespread adoption of Peloton’s unique fitness platform, which combines live classes, on-demand workouts, and personalized training.

In the year 2022, Peloton members collectively completed over 570 million workouts, marking a substantial 25% increase from the previous year. This impressive statistic underscores the active participation and engagement of Peloton users, highlighting the platform’s ability to motivate and inspire individuals to achieve their fitness goals.
